Directions

  1. In saucepan, combine jelly and mustard. Stir in pineapple juice and sherry. Cook and stir to boiling. Simmer 2 or possibly 3 min. Set aside about 1/3 c. of sauce for basting ham.
  2. Add in cherry pie filling and raisins to remaining sauce. Bring to boil, stirring. Lower heat and simmer 5-10 min. Stir occasionally to prevent sticking. Can be made several days ahead and heat before serving.
